Adorabelle Tea Room & Gift Shop: Worlds Away in Steveston by Sarah Gordon

photos by Sandra Steier

Adorabelle Tea Room & Gift Shop is housed inside the cheerful lemon yellow historic Steveston Court House. The interior is charming with feminine touches in a relaxing palette of pale pink, white and black. A variety of repurposed furniture painted white, plays a role in making Adorabelle simply ‘adorable’. You will notice the Eiffel Tower is paid homage to throughout the tea room. An illuminated light panel above one of the seating areas will make you feel like you are staring up at the Eiffel Tower on a sunny day. Other small scale versions are placed around the room, which according to Cathy Hayes, who owns the business along with her husband Chris Hayes, is thanks to Chris’s love of the French monument. Pieces:

A Special Place to find the Perfect Gift photos by Sandra Steier “I love this shop” is one of the most rewarding compliments Pieces receives and it consistently makes David and Sarah Gordon smile. Before they purchased the business, Sarah Gordon would bring her friends into the shop and utter those very words. An undeniable part of Pieces’ charm is its location. The magic is housed inside the venerable red brick Hepworth Block, which has stood on Moncton Street for almost 100 years (2013 marks its centenary). This landmark building survived the great fire of 1918 when most of Steveston burnt to the ground. You can see a physical reminder of the fire on a scorched pillar inside the shop. Customers have used words such as exquisite, tasteful and whimsical to describe Pieces, and some fondly refer to it as their “go to” store. Pieces takes pride in an “Especially Canadian” focus. Pay It Forward by Sarah Gordon She couldn’t have caught me on a worse day. My first cold of the season had left me feeling bedraggled and on top of that I had to face Costco on a Friday morning, which requires all of my strength at the best of times. I paused to study the nutritional value of cheese strings when a woman approached me and asked if I knew where she might find tofu. She told me that I looked healthy and felt that I would be able to help her. Having made my day, of course I was eager to assist and offered a few suggestions. After a few comments and smiles I wished her luck and we said goodbye. As soon as she left I decided I would make it my quest to not only locate the tofu, like a needle in the Costco haystack, but also to find her again and report back. It took me approximately five minutes and voilà, my mission was accomplished. Feeling very touched she told me she was going to pay my kindness forward. Before going shopping I had been at a school assembly where the inspiring principal passed on a message to the school’s 450 students about moving from “me to we” thinking, namely to be positive, to share and to help others. This message certainly registered with me and I thank him for his gentle reminder. I recently read a column in The Vancouver Sun written by Craig and Marc Kielburger which was very inspiring. Ringette: The Fastest Game on Ice by Sarah Gordon

photos submitted

“What exactly is ringette?” is a question often associated with this sport which is sometimes mistaken for a version of girls’ hockey. Laura Takasaki, a coach with Richmond Ringette, chuckles when asked, and is eager to correct the misconception as she is a great believer in the game that she has played for thirty years. Like hockey, ringette is an ice sport, however, rather than playing with a hockey stick and a puck, the players use a straight stick and a rubber ring (imagine a 6” hollow blue doughnut). The greatest difference between the two sports is obstruction and interference are prohibited in ringette. In many ways the game shares more in common with basketball, soccer and lacrosse in terms of its offensive and defensive play. In 1963 Sam Jacks, from North Bay, Ontario (also the inventor of floor hockey), developed ringette as an alternative ice game for girls at a time when hockey was for boys only. The objective is to score on the opponent by shooting the ring into their net. The challenge lies in skating while catching or "stabbing" the ring. Physical contact is not allowed. Once stabbed, the ring is easier to control than a puck, but ringette's blue-line rules force more passing. As a result, players learn teamwork rather than depending on one or two dominant players. their skating, which increases the tempo of the game, and has earned ringette the bragging rights of being ‘the fastest game on ice’. Most games last approximately one hour. As the pace is very fast, players get plenty of ice time. Six players from each team are allowed on the ice at one time; one goalie, two defense, two forwards, and one centre. The players wear full protective equipment including a distinctive face mask, a jersey and long pants. The goalie uses regular goal catcher’s equipment; however, some goalies use a unique catching glove. Ringette is played throughout Canada at many different levels, from house league to all-stars and in national and international competition. In Canada, 50,000 athletes, coaches, and officials call ringette their sport. Takasaki is proud to report that there are a couple of Richmond players on the B.C. Thunder National Ringette team. This sport builds strong, fit and confident girls, yet even though the game is not limited to females, the membership is still largely female. Involvement in sports teaches valuable life lessons such as commitment, time-management, goal-setting, teamwork and respect. Ringette devotees also list the friendships they form as one of the top

December 2012 - January 2013 • www.StevestonInsider.com


reasons they love being involved in the sport. Children can begin playing as young as five years old, and the beauty is you don’t even need to know how to skate, you can learn as you go! Ringette is also gentle on the pocketbook. Startup costs are approximately $100 and rental equipment is available for players for the first year. After that time, when you become hooked on ringette, as Takasaki says you will, you can purchase your own gear. Ringette’s age divisions include U9 (Bunnies) ages 4-7, U10 (Novice) ages 7-9, U12 (Petite) ages 10-11, U14 (Tween) ages 12-13, U16 (Junior) ages 14-15, U19 (Belle) ages 16-18, Open 18 years+ and Masters 30 years+.
